Output 323c05a9f18371da7bdd053e9687d08c1036581512f8da90940393def204cb5f:0

value
5632822
script pubkey
OP_0 OP_PUSHBYTES_20 ef4ad5f463e6df498889d192b11a3f1581413e82
address
ltc1qaa9dtarrum05nzyf6xftzx3lzkq5z05z83ywf7
transaction
323c05a9f18371da7bdd053e9687d08c1036581512f8da90940393def204cb5f
spent
true